Passerby66 11:20 Tue Feb 20
Re: Eubank Jr vs Groves
The difference between Smith and Eubank is that Smith is a much taller man and also has a long history in amateur boxing.

Groves will not just be able to keep him on the end of his jab all night and will instead potentially be the one on the end of Smith's jab.

Smith is 6'3" with a 78 inch reach and Groves is 6ft with a 72 inch reach. Smith poses a toally differnet problem for Groves.

Not saying he won't win but to think it will be a walk in the park is wrong. Smith is a very very live challenger.

Russ of the BML 1:44 Mon Feb 19
Re: Eubank Jr vs Groves
Trev - Yes, they were urging him to go forward. You are right.

But when he did he got tagged by Grove's jab or tied up on the ropes. It's ok to say to a boxer keep going forward but if it's not working and he is getting a jab in the nose each time then what do you do?

Eubank does not have power to knock out Groves. He couldn't out jab him. He tried moving forward and got out-jabbed. When he got inside he was ineffective and Groves easily contained him.

So his camp just kept saying 'Move forward'. Seems like the game-plan wasn't right??

But yeah you are right, it was similar to the BJS fight. Too little too late. But to be fair to Jnr the plan wasn't working and early on you could see it was going to be a disaster for him.
